This West African little ball-shaped, deep fried doughnut is a common food, however it bears several names from country to country. It is called togbei and bofrot in Ghana but also puff puff, kala or mikate, beinye and ligemat in other West African countries including Nigeria, Cameroon and Sierra Leone, while South and East Africa call their doughnut, mandazi. Drop donuts are popularly known as Puff puff in Nigeria or Bofrot in Ghana, depending on where in West Africa you hear about them. Puff puff or bofrot are an easy to make, versatile street snack that are quite popular in many West African homes, as small chops (Nigerian slang for appetizers) at parties or weddings, as breakfast or as a quick snack.

Andazi is the word used in the singular form while the word mandazi is plural to define these African donuts. Kiswahili, a vernacular language, is a Bantu language originally from Tanzania that has mixed with other African languages and Arabic. Today, it plays an important role as a lingua franca in much of sub-Saharan Africa.
